Mhango, MO; Dyani-Mhango, N and Ndumo, M. Pension Law and Death Benefits: Law, Practice and Policy Harmonisation in the Southern African Development Community (SADC). – Juta, 2022.


ISBN: 9781485138914


Publisher’s summary: “Pension Law and Death Benefits: Law, Practice and Policy Harmonisation in the Southern African Development Community (SADC) discusses the complex area of pension law relating to the distribution of death benefits in the SADC region, with a focus on developments in South Africa, Botswana, Malawi, Eswatini and Lesotho. When a member of a pension fund dies in any of these five countries, there are specific provisions in the law that regulate how their death benefits should be distributed.

The book is predicated on the specific practices in these countries but also on the obligations of SADC countries to harmonise their laws governing pension funds. It demonstrates how these countries have harmonised their laws, policies, and practices in death benefits to prevent regulatory arbitrage and promote greater integration. Given this harmonisation project, the book discusses how judiciaries and tribunals in these countries have developed the law in a manner that promotes these goals.”
